Canada’s Laurence Vincent-Lapointe wins silver in 200m canoe sprint

Canada’s Laurence Vincent-Lapointe of Trois-Rivières, Que., has won the silver medal in the women’s 200-metre canoe sprint race at the 2020 Tokyo Olympics.

This is the first time women have competed in canoe events at the Olympic Games.
